#4d0dda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d0dda is composed of 30.2% red, 5.1%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.7% cyan, 94%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 258.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 45.3%. #4d0dda color hex could be obtained by blending #9a1aff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#4d0dda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d0dda has RGB values of R:77, G:13,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5049818.

Shades and Tints of #4d0dda
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010e is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d0dda
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726f78 is the less saturated color, while #4a04e3 is the most saturated one.
